TODAY
Birka is located in Ashland, KY. Birka is based on the Swedish settlement of the same name in the time period around 1000 A.D. And while there are many who’s personas are Norse and Swedish, we welcome all. As in the days of the original Birka settlement, visitors from the known world traveled to their markets to both buy and sell their wares.
ACTIVITIES
Birka engages in all forms of marshal activities with heavy rattan combat, cut & thrust fencing, and some fun with foam weapons ensues.
With several Masters of Arts, folc have the ability to learn a variety of medieval arts and skills. Some of our activities are medieval cooking, leatherwork, metalwork, singing and bardic arts, dancing, calligraphy and illumination, and costuming to name a few.
